Nutrition Facts

Pork roll, cured, fried

Serving Size: slice (1 oz) (28g)

* Amount Per Serving
Calories 97.2 cal
Calories from Fat 81 cal
% Daily Value
Total Fat 9 g 13.8%
Saturated Fat 3.1 g 15.6%
Cholesterol 16.8 mg 5.6%
Sodium 290.4 mg 12.1%
Total Carbohydrate 0.6 g 0.2%
Dietary Fiber 0 g 0%
Sugars (Added) 0 g 0%
Protein 3.4 g 6.8%
 
Vitamins
Vitamin A 0 IU 0%
Vitamin B6 0.1 mg 2.9%
Vitamin B12 0.2 mcg 4.1%
Vitamin C 0.3 mg 0.5%
Vitamin D 0.1 mcg 0%
Vitamin E 0 mg 0%
Vitamin K 0.4 mcg 0.5%
 
Minerals
Calcium (Ca) 1.7 mg 0.3%
Copper (Cu) 0 mg 0.5%
Iron (Fe) 0.2 mg 1.1%
Magnesium (Mg) 2.8 mg 0.7%
Manganese (Mn) 0 mg 0%
Potassium (K) 58.8 mg 1.7%
Phosphorus (P) 22.4 mg 2.2%
Selenium (Se) 7.6 mcg 10.9%
Zinc (Zn) 0.4 mg 2.7%
